Baby Jogger City Select Stroller & City Select Car Seat

The City Select 2 Stroller Eco Collection is a versatile stroller that can be used for multiple purposes. It can be transformed from a single stroller to double strollers by adding an additional seat (sold separately) or a glider board. The City Select 2 Stroller Eco Collection is able to be set up into a triple-travel system by adding a bench or infant car seat. It offers 24 configurations in all and is the top-rated stroller. This model is made with Baby Jogger's soft durable, breathable and sustainably-sourced TENCEL fabrics. They aid in regulating the temperature. It has a leatherette handlebar, bumper bar and belly bar. It is 20percent smaller and lighter than the top single-to-double stroller, the UPPAbaby V2.

It features a medium-sized shade as well as an e-snap-aboo window that is simple to open or close. The telescoping handlebar is one of the most simple to adjust and works well for parents of all sizes. The seats recline and there's a footwell adjuster button to help you position your child in the most comfortable position. The storage bin is large, but we wish it had a latch that was more secure. The bin is easy to open, however the zippers are a bit annoying because they need to be unfastened and then secured again after each use.

The City Select, like its siblings, has single-action breaks that are simple to install and release by pulling a lever on the frame side, lower than the handlebar. It is sandal- and barefoot friendly and a step up from the awkward brake levers that some competitors use.


This is the only stroller we've examined that accepts two infant seats. It's a great option for parents with twins or expecting a baby soon. It can fit most infant car seats from major brands by using an adapter. We tested it using Britax/BOB Chicco KeyFit 30, Graco Click Connect models Cybex Aton and Aton Q, and Nuna Pipa.
